Microchipping

Thousands of pets are lost every year and many are never reunited with their owners. The RSPCA believes that the best way to make sure you find your missing pet is to have it microchipped - implanted with a special microchip 'tag'.

Microchipping is as simple as an injection. A tiny microchip the size of a grain of rice is painlessly inserted under your pet's skin. Once in place it cannot move or be seen, but can be read by a scanner.

Neutering

It's a mistake to leave your dog or cat unneutered whether it's male or female. There are already thousands of unwanted animals in RSPCA and other charity run animal centres.

Neutering couldn't be simpler. Contact your veterinary surgeon to find out the cost and arrange an appointment. You will probably have to take your pet to the surgery early in the morning and collect it at the end of the day. It's a routine operation and most animals are back on their feet again straight away.
